-/**
- * Imports.
- */
-import { GlobalTestState, MerchantPrivateApi } from "../harness/harness.js";
-import {
- createSimpleTestkudosEnvironment,
- withdrawViaBank,
-} from "../harness/helpers.js";
-import {
- PreparePayResultType,
- codecForMerchantOrderStatusUnpaid,
- ConfirmPayResultType,
- URL,
-} from "@gnu-taler/taler-util";
-import axiosImp from "axios";
-const axios = axiosImp.default;
-import { WalletApiOperation } from "@gnu-taler/taler-wallet-core";
-
-/**
- * Run test for basic, bank-integrated withdrawal.
- */
-export async function runPaywallFlowTest(t: GlobalTestState) {
- // Set up test environment
-
- const { wallet, bank, exchange, merchant } =
- await createSimpleTestkudosEnvironment(t);
-
- // Withdraw digital cash into the wallet.
-
- await withdrawViaBank(t, { wallet, bank, exchange, amount: "TESTKUDOS:20" });
-
- /**
- * =========================================================================
- * Create an order and let the wallet pay under a session ID
- *
- * We check along the way that the JSON response to /orders/{order_id}
- * returns the right thing.
- * =========================================================================
- */
-
- let orderResp = await MerchantPrivateApi.createOrder(merchant, "default", {
- order: {
- summary: "Buy me!",
- amount: "TESTKUDOS:5",
- fulfillment_url: "https://example.com/article42",
- public_reorder_url: "https://example.com/article42-share",
- },
- });
-
- const firstOrderId = orderResp.order_id;
-
- let orderStatus = await MerchantPrivateApi.queryPrivateOrderStatus(merchant, {
- orderId: orderResp.order_id,
- sessionId: "mysession-one",
- });
-
- t.assertTrue(orderStatus.order_status === "unpaid");
-
- const talerPayUriOne = orderStatus.taler_pay_uri;
-
- t.assertTrue(orderStatus.already_paid_order_id === undefined);
- let publicOrderStatusUrl = new URL(orderStatus.order_status_url);
-
- let publicOrderStatusResp = await axios.get(publicOrderStatusUrl.href, {
- validateStatus: () => true,
- });
-
- if (publicOrderStatusResp.status != 402) {
- throw Error(
- `expected status 402 (before claiming), but got ${publicOrderStatusResp.status}`,
- );
- }
-
- let pubUnpaidStatus = codecForMerchantOrderStatusUnpaid().decode(
- publicOrderStatusResp.data,
- );
-
- console.log(pubUnpaidStatus);
-
- let preparePayResp = await wallet.client.call(
- WalletApiOperation.PreparePayForUri,
- {
- talerPayUri: pubUnpaidStatus.taler_pay_uri,
- },
- );
-
- t.assertTrue(preparePayResp.status === PreparePayResultType.PaymentPossible);
-
- const proposalId = preparePayResp.proposalId;
-
- console.log("requesting", publicOrderStatusUrl.href);
- publicOrderStatusResp = await axios.get(publicOrderStatusUrl.href, {
- validateStatus: () => true,
- });
- console.log("response body", publicOrderStatusResp.data);
- if (publicOrderStatusResp.status != 402) {
- throw Error(
- `expected status 402 (after claiming), but got ${publicOrderStatusResp.status}`,
- );
- }
-
- pubUnpaidStatus = codecForMerchantOrderStatusUnpaid().decode(
- publicOrderStatusResp.data,
- );
-
- const confirmPayRes = await wallet.client.call(
- WalletApiOperation.ConfirmPay,
- {
- proposalId: proposalId,
- },
- );
-
- t.assertTrue(confirmPayRes.type === ConfirmPayResultType.Done);
-
- publicOrderStatusResp = await axios.get(publicOrderStatusUrl.href, {
- validateStatus: () => true,
- });
-
- console.log(publicOrderStatusResp.data);
-
- if (publicOrderStatusResp.status != 200) {
- console.log(publicOrderStatusResp.data);
- throw Error(
- `expected status 200 (after paying), but got ${publicOrderStatusResp.status}`,
- );
- }
-
- /**
- * =========================================================================
- * Now change up the session ID!
- * =========================================================================
- */
-
- orderStatus = await MerchantPrivateApi.queryPrivateOrderStatus(merchant, {
- orderId: orderResp.order_id,
- sessionId: "mysession-two",
- });
-
- // Should be claimed (not paid!) because of a new session ID
- t.assertTrue(orderStatus.order_status === "claimed");
-
- // Pay with new taler://pay URI, which should
- // have the new session ID!
- // Wallet should now automatically re-play payment.
- preparePayResp = await wallet.client.call(
- WalletApiOperation.PreparePayForUri,
- {
- talerPayUri: talerPayUriOne,
- },
- );
-
- t.assertTrue(preparePayResp.status === PreparePayResultType.AlreadyConfirmed);
- t.assertTrue(preparePayResp.paid);
-
- /**
- * =========================================================================
- * Now we test re-purchase detection.
- * =========================================================================
- */
-
- orderResp = await MerchantPrivateApi.createOrder(merchant, "default", {
- order: {
- summary: "Buy me!",
- amount: "TESTKUDOS:5",
- // Same fulfillment URL as previously!
- fulfillment_url: "https://example.com/article42",
- public_reorder_url: "https://example.com/article42-share",
- },
- });
-
- const secondOrderId = orderResp.order_id;
-
- orderStatus = await MerchantPrivateApi.queryPrivateOrderStatus(merchant, {
- orderId: secondOrderId,
- sessionId: "mysession-three",
- });
-
- t.assertTrue(orderStatus.order_status === "unpaid");
-
- t.assertTrue(orderStatus.already_paid_order_id === undefined);
- publicOrderStatusUrl = new URL(orderStatus.order_status_url);
-
- // Here the re-purchase detection should kick in,
- // and the wallet should re-pay for the old order
- // under the new session ID (mysession-three).
- preparePayResp = await wallet.client.call(
- WalletApiOperation.PreparePayForUri,
- {
- talerPayUri: orderStatus.taler_pay_uri,
- },
- );
-
- t.assertTrue(preparePayResp.status === PreparePayResultType.AlreadyConfirmed);
- t.assertTrue(preparePayResp.paid);
-
- // The first order should now be paid under "mysession-three",
- // as the wallet did re-purchase detection
- orderStatus = await MerchantPrivateApi.queryPrivateOrderStatus(merchant, {
- orderId: firstOrderId,
- sessionId: "mysession-three",
- });
-
- t.assertTrue(orderStatus.order_status === "paid");
-
- // Check that with a completely new session ID, the status would NOT
- // be paid.
- orderStatus = await MerchantPrivateApi.queryPrivateOrderStatus(merchant, {
- orderId: firstOrderId,
- sessionId: "mysession-four",
- });
-
- t.assertTrue(orderStatus.order_status === "claimed");
-
- // Now check if the public status of the new order is correct.
-
- console.log("requesting public status", publicOrderStatusUrl);
-
- // Ask the order status of the claimed-but-unpaid order
- publicOrderStatusResp = await axios.get(publicOrderStatusUrl.href, {
- validateStatus: () => true,
- });
-
- if (publicOrderStatusResp.status != 402) {
- throw Error(`expected status 402, but got ${publicOrderStatusResp.status}`);
- }
-
- pubUnpaidStatus = codecForMerchantOrderStatusUnpaid().decode(
- publicOrderStatusResp.data,
- );
-
- console.log(publicOrderStatusResp.data);
-
- t.assertTrue(pubUnpaidStatus.already_paid_order_id === firstOrderId);
-}
-
-runPaywallFlowTest.suites = ["merchant", "wallet"];
